虚拟主机问题之IIS连接数和在线人数的解释
- 格式:doc
- 大小:25.50 KB
- 文档页数:1
IIS详细说明iis目录[隐藏]IIS之Web服务器对IIS服务的远程管理有关IIS的常见问题解答IIS之FTP服务器IIS之SMTP服务器IIS 状态解释IIS相关总结IIS 5.1和IIS 6.0一些显著的重要区别关于IISIIS概念相关1、IIS(Inter-IC Sound bu s)又称I2S,是菲利浦公司提出的串行数字音频总线协议[1]。
目前很多音频芯片和MCU都提供了对IIS的支持。
IIS总线只处理声音数据。
其他信号(如控制信号)必须单独传输。
为了使芯片的引出管脚尽可能少,IIS只使用了三根串行总线。
这三根线分别是:提供分时复用功能的数据线、字段选择线(声道选择)、时钟信号线。
2、IIS是Internet Information Servi ces的缩写,是一个World Wide Web serv er。
Gopher server和FTP server全部包容在里面。
IIS意味着你能发布网页,并且有A SP(Active Server Pages)、JAVA、VBs cript产生页面,有着一些扩展功能。
IIS支持一些有趣的东西,象有编辑环境的界面(FRO NTPAGE)、有全文检索功能的(INDEX SE RVER)、有多媒体功能的(NET SHOW)其次,IIS是随Windows NT Server 4.0一起提供的文件和应用程序服务器,是在Window s NT Server上建立Internet服务器的基本组件。
它与Windows NT Server完全集成,允许使用Windows NT Server内置的安全性以及NTFS文件系统建立强大灵活的Intern et/Intranet站点。
IIS(Internet Informati on Server,互联网信息服务)是一种Web(网页)服务组件,其中包括Web服务器、FTP 服务器、NNTP服务器和SMTP服务器,分别用于网页浏览、文件传输、新闻服务和邮件发送等方面,它使得在网络(包括互联网和局域网)上发布信息成了一件很容易的事。
IIS指标监测说明IIS(Internet Information Services)是一种基于Windows操作系统的Web服务器软件,用于托管和管理Web应用程序和网站。
IIS的指标监测是一种重要的运维工作,可以帮助管理员了解服务器的状态和性能,并及时采取措施来优化和维护服务器的运行。
在进行IIS指标监测之前,首先需要了解一些基本的指标概念。
以下是一些常见的IIS指标说明:1.CPU利用率:表示当前CPU的使用情况,通常以百分比的形式显示。
高CPU利用率意味着服务器正处于高负载状态,可能会导致响应时间变慢或服务不可用。
2.内存使用量:表示服务器当前使用的内存量,通常以百分比的形式显示。
高内存使用量可能会导致服务器的响应速度下降或者崩溃。
3.硬盘空间:表示服务器硬盘上剩余的可用空间。
当硬盘空间不足时,可能会导致文件无法写入或读取,影响网站的正常运行。
4.网络带宽:表示服务器上可用的网络传输带宽。
高网络带宽利用率意味着服务器正在处理大量的网络流量,可能导致响应时间延迟或者服务不可用。
除了以上基本的指标监测外,还有一些与IIS的性能和健康状态相关的特定指标,包括但不限于:1.处理请求的速度:表示服务器处理请求的速度,通常以请求每秒的数量来衡量。
高速率表示服务器正在处理高负载的请求,并且反应良好。
2.平均响应时间:表示服务器处理请求所需的平均时间,通常以毫秒为单位。
低响应时间意味着服务器能够快速响应请求,提供良好的用户体验。
3.请求错误率:表示服务器处理请求时发生错误的比例。
高错误率可能意味着服务器上存在配置问题或者应用程序错误,需要及时排查和修复。
4.并发连接数:表示服务器当前正在处理的并发连接数量。
高并发连接数可能会导致服务器性能下降,并且可能导致无法处理新的连接请求。
以上所述的这些指标只是IIS监测中的一部分,具体应根据实际情况和需求来确定需要监测的指标。
监测这些指标可以通过不同方式实现,包括但不限于以下几个方面:1.IIS自带的性能监视器:IIS自带了一些性能监视器,可以通过IIS管理器来查看和配置。
iis名词解释IIS,即Internet Information Services(互联网信息服务),是由微软开发的一种Web服务器软件。
它是在Windows操作系统上运行的,用于托管和提供网站、应用程序和其他互联网服务。
IIS的主要功能包括:1. Web服务器功能:IIS可以处理HTTP和HTTPS请求,并提供用于托管和发布网站的基础设施。
它支持与、PHP、Python等多种Web编程语言的集成,使开发人员可以使用各种技术来构建动态和交互式的网站。
2. 应用程序池:IIS使用应用程序池来隔离不同的网站和应用程序。
每个应用程序池都有一个独立的进程来处理用户请求,确保在一个应用程序出现故障时,其他应用程序不受影响。
3. 身份验证和授权:IIS提供多种身份验证和授权机制,如基本身份验证、Windows身份验证、表单身份验证等。
它还支持集成Windows Active Directory和其他身份提供者,使用户能够在访问受保护资源时进行身份验证和授权。
4. 动态内容压缩:IIS具有动态内容压缩功能,可以通过压缩响应数据来减少传输的数据量,提高网站的性能和响应速度。
这对于处理大量的静态和动态内容的网站特别有用。
5. 管理工具:IIS提供了一套管理工具,例如IIS管理控制台、PowerShell命令行工具等,用于配置、监视和管理网站和应用程序。
管理员可以使用这些工具来设置网站设置、监视性能和日志记录、设置安全等。
6. 扩展性:IIS支持扩展模块和插件的开发,可以根据特定的需求添加自定义功能。
这为开发人员提供了自定义网站和应用程序的能力,以满足不同的业务需求。
总之,IIS是一种强大的Web服务器软件,它提供了许多功能和工具,使开发人员能够轻松地托管、管理和提供网站和应用程序。
通过其广泛的功能和灵活性,IIS成为了许多企业和个人开发者的首选Web服务器平台。
如何查看IIS并发连接数及性能优化如果要查看IIS连接数,最简单方便的方法是通过“网站统计”来查看,“网站统计”的当前在线人数可以认为是当前IIS连接数。
然而,“网站统计”的当前在线人数统计时间较长,一般为10分钟或15分钟,再加上统计技术及统计机制的问题,从而会产生或多或少的统计误差。
如果要想知道确切的当前网站IIS连接数的话,最有效的方法是通过windows自带的系统监视器来查看。
这正是本文要介绍的方法。
一、新建IIS并发连接数监控器
1.运行-->输入“perfmon.msc”
2.在“系统监视器”图表区域里点击右键,然后点“添加计数器”
图一
3.在“添加计数器”窗口,“性能对象”选择Web Service,“从列表选择计数器”选中Current Connection,“从列表选择实例”选中你要统计的站点,最后点击“添加”按钮
图二
二、设置完毕
这样,你就可以在“系统监视器”图表区域中看到一条曲线(此曲线你可以设置其颜色和宽度等参数),它就是网站的IIS连接数曲线图了,如图一黄色曲线所示。
需要说明的是,windows系统监视器显示的是即时IIS并发连接数,并非如“网站统计”那里的15分钟内访问人数,所以你会发现IIS并发连接数并不会太多
三、修改WEB园性能
打开“应用程序池”,点击【性能】,“web园”最大工作进程数改为“5”,如图三
图三。
服务器授权模式每服务器同时连接数与每设备或每⽤户的区别⼩结每服务器认证:指允许服务可以同时有多少个并发客户端⽤户访问的数量;每客户认证:指你的每个客户端都有认证许可,客户端通过这个认证访问服务器;公司有两台服务器:Server1,Server2;客户端:100台;若你选择每服务器认证,这个你就需要为Server1,Server2各选择100个认证,共计200个认证,才能满⾜100个客户端同时访问;若你选择每客户认证,你只需100个客户认证,就能满⾜100个客户端访问的需求;⽤户可以根据⾃⼰的需求选择不同的认证⽅式.将本地服务器更改为每设备或每⽤户授权1.在要配置的服务器上,打开“选择授权模式”。
2. 在“产品”中,单击要更改授权模式的产品。
3.单击“每设备或每⽤户”。
要打开某个“控制⾯板”项⽬,请单击“开始”,单击“控制⾯板”,然后双击“授权”。
可以配置 IIS 指定 Web 站点⽬录的下列权限,如读访问权限和⽬录浏览权限。
理解 Web 服务器权限和 NTFS 权限之间的区别很重要。
和 NTFS 不同,Web 服务器权限适⽤于访问 Web 和 FTP 站点的所有⽤户。
NTFS 权限只适⽤于拥有有效 Windows 帐号的特定⽤户或⽤户组。
NTFS 控制对服务器上物理⽬录的访问,⽽ Web 和 FTP 权限控制对 Web 或 FTP 站点上虚拟⽬录的访问。
如果您选择“每设备或每⽤户”模式,那么访问运⾏ Windows Server 2003 家族产品的服务器的每台设备或每个⽤户都必须具备单独的“客户端访问许可证 (CAL)”。
通过⼀个 CAL,特定设备或⽤户可以连接到运⾏ Windows Server 2003 家族产品的任意数量的服务器。
拥有多台运⾏ Windows Server 2003 家族产品的服务器的公司⼤多采⽤这种授权⽅法。
相反,每服务器许可证是指每个与此服务器的并发连接都需要⼀个单独的 CAL。
一、IIS连接数客户请求的连接内容包括:1、网站html请求,html中的图片资源,html中的脚本资源,其他需要连接下载的资源等等,任何一个资源的请求即一次连接(虽然有的资源请求连接响应很快)2、如果网页采用框架(框架内部嵌套网页请求),那么一个框架即一次连接3、如果网页弹出窗口(窗口内部嵌套网页请求),那么一个窗口一个连接二、IIS并发连接数“管理网站”->“高级设置”->"限制"->"最大并发连接数"其实,普通用户常说的“IIS连接数”就是这边的“最大并发连接数”这边默认最大并发连接数为:4294967295,这是一个很惊人的数字,难道这代表着网站能具有并发执行连接数为4294967295的能力?每个连接的处理,IIS都会开启一个线程去处理,假设这个处理方式成立,那么4294967295个并发连接请求来了是否IIS会立即启动4294967295个线程去处理?这是很多人的误区,假设4294967295并发连接同时来了,IIS不会立即启动4294967295个线程去处理,因为这不现实,对于处理连接,IIS是有“最大并发工作线程数”限制的,该数字跟操作系统相关,win7系统的IIS的值是10(或者其他不确定),VS2012自带的IIS Express的值是80。
对于windows服务器版本的系统的具体值不清楚,即4294967295个并发连接来了后,(这边以win7下的10为例),iis第一时间只能启动10个工作线程去处理,那么其他4294967285必须排队,排队对用户的体验来说就是网页正在加载,但是什么都不显示,另外,如果web服务器的硬件设备很高端,那么IIS的工作线程也会处理的更快,那么响应的用户等待的时间也会更短(前提是你的IIS连接数够大哦,否则就直接503)总的来说,最大并发连接数,影响了排队的数量很多时候需要我们评估自己的网站的最大并发连接数,然后来进行设置最佳数量三、队列长度队列长度:在IIS中选中【应用程序池】,在应用程序池列表中,右键你想查看的,在右键菜单中选择【高级设置】。
名词解释iis名词解释IISIIS,全称为Internet Information Services,是一款由微软公司开发的Web服务器软件。
它是Windows操作系统的一部分,可以用于托管和管理网站、应用程序和Web服务。
下面将从不同的角度对IIS进行解释。
一、IIS的历史IIS最初是在1995年发布的,当时它被称为Internet Information Server。
它是Windows NT 3.51操作系统的一部分,用于托管和管理网站。
随着Windows操作系统的不断更新,IIS也不断发展壮大。
目前,最新版本的IIS是IIS 10.0,它是Windows Server 2016操作系统的一部分。
二、IIS的功能IIS具有多种功能,包括:1. Web服务器:IIS可以作为Web服务器来托管和管理网站。
它支持多种Web技术,如、PHP、CGI等。
2. 应用程序服务器:IIS可以作为应用程序服务器来托管和管理应用程序。
它支持多种应用程序技术,如、WCF、Web API等。
3. FTP服务器:IIS可以作为FTP服务器来托管和管理FTP站点。
它支持多种FTP技术,如FTP、SFTP等。
4. SMTP服务器:IIS可以作为SMTP服务器来托管和管理邮件服务。
它支持多种邮件技术,如SMTP、POP3、IMAP等。
5. 安全性:IIS具有多种安全性功能,如SSL、IP限制、认证等。
这些功能可以保护网站和应用程序的安全性。
三、IIS的优点IIS具有多种优点,包括:1. 易于使用:IIS具有友好的用户界面和易于使用的管理工具,使得用户可以轻松地管理网站和应用程序。
2. 可扩展性:IIS支持多种扩展,如ISAPI、模块等。
这些扩展可以增强IIS的功能和性能。
3. 高性能:IIS具有高性能和高可靠性,可以处理大量的请求和流量。
4. 兼容性:IIS支持多种Web技术和应用程序技术,可以与多种操作系统和开发工具兼容。
怎样计算服务器托管带宽与在线人数服务器托管对于网站来说是举足轻重的,选择一个好的服务器就直接关系到了网站的发展,服务器的重要性是不言而喻的,那么站长们是否会计算服务器托管带宽与在线人数呢?专职优化、域名注册、网站空间、虚拟主机、服务器托管、vps主机、服务器租用的中国信息港来为你探究!计算机上有两个最基本的单位,Byte(字节)和bit(位),二者的换算关系是1Byte=8bits。
其他的K、M、G、T等都是数量级。
100Mbps(100M bits per second)独享带宽,换算到我们日常熟悉的文件大小,要除以8;也就是说100Mbps带宽,理论下每秒可以下载的文件大小约是12.5MB(M Byte).如果再加上损耗,IP头等,大概也就10MB/S左右。
如果你是用这10M去点播普通电影(600kbps)的,产生一次顺畅点播需要每秒传递的数据大小600/8≈80KB左右,10240K/80,也就120个同时链接(并发)。
当然如果你要是做网页的话,每个人需要的带宽大约也就5k /s左右,也就是2000来个同时连接(并发)。
通常意义上来讲,做网页服务器,用带宽来计算同时在线人数是不准确的,你同样可以支持1万个人在线,因为访问网页的时候只是短时间连接服务器请求数据,这 1万人未必同时需要1万个并发连接。
网页人数的在线,主要是跟服务器的性能相关。
视频服务器或者下载服务器,游戏服务器,才跟带宽直接相关。
三带宽能同时允许在线人数多少?带宽方面是支持在线人数的最关键的一个因素,服务器按照咱们所保证的百共保证带宽是3M,即3Mbit/s,相应的,服务器的数据最高传输速度应为3 /8byte/s*1024=384K/s 。
一分钟流量大约384K/S*60=23040K,假使每个用户一分钟内占用10K,即该一分钟内支持在线访问人数为2304人。
(图片类和视频类站点不在此例,因为图片类视频类每个用户一分钟内绝对超过10K),但是,我们并不能保证每个用户在一分钟内只访问一个该站链接,假如每个用户在一分钟内点该站两个链接的话,那么支持在线人数应该在2000以下。
虚拟主机问题之IIS连接数和在线人数的解释
有很多用户可能碰到过这样的情况:我购买的是100人在线,为什么论坛在线能到150人以上,也有用户提出为什么我买的是100人在线为什么论坛到不了100人。
具体解释如下:
1、IIS连接量是指在一定时间的统计内,对站点的80端口访问的数量,现在一般理解为同时在线人数。
2、论坛在线人数是论坛一定时间内的活动用户数(时间可以自己设定)
不难理解:
(1)如果不考虑任何的下载和连接,您的的论坛支持在线人数肯定能超过IIS连接数,就是说您在我们或其他空间商处购买了100人在线的空间,如果您只放一个论坛,采用论坛默认方式时,您的论坛支持人数肯定大于100人。
这个值要按照您的设置来定。
(2)如果您的网站放了下载或是其他网站转用了您的文件,这些也将占用您的在线人数。
尤其是用网络蚂蚁一类软件,他的每个点就表示一个连接。
当这些连接过多的话,您的论坛支持人数自然就会大大下降。
所以尽量不放下载,并且做友情连接时应该让对方网站把您的LOGO图片保存到他的网站。
还有就是要从程序入手,尤其是论坛,要最大程度上优化程序,不占用过多的资源,这样可以解决一般的IIS连接数不足的问题。
所以大多数问题是自己可以解决的。
当然有时候网站不能访问也不会全是IIS连接数的原因,所以也不能一概而论!。